Chair - Department of Biochemistry, Microbiology and Immunology at the University of Ottawa

The University of Ottawa is Canada’s largest bilingual institution of higher learning and research. The Faculty of Medicine — one of Canada’s five most research-intensive faculties, with over CAN$140 million of research funding annually, state of art facilities — seeks a dynamic academic leader as Chair of its Department of Biochemistry, Microbiology and Immunology (BMI). The Department of BMI is made up of over 100 full-time and cross-appointed scientists with strong ties to several other basic science and clinical departments and hospital-based research institutes. Currently, the Faculty has over 600 students in graduate and postdoctoral studies, distributed across several programs.

The successful candidate will have a demonstrated track record of academic and research excellence with appropriate communication, management and administrative abilities to promote innovation within his or her respective department and throughout the Faculty, including with several research institutes (University of Ottawa Brain and Mind Research Institute, Ottawa Hospital Research Institute, Children’s Hospital of Eastern Ontario Research Institute, University of Ottawa Institute of Mental Health Research, Élisabeth Bruyère Research Institute, University of Ottawa Heart Institute and the Montfort Hospital Research Institute). Candidates should have a strong record of achievement and innovation in research in one or more relevant disciplines to BMI.

Active knowledge of either English or French is a must and have a stated level of competence (active or passive) in the other official language is preferred. Appointment to the Faculty of Medicine will be made at the appropriate academic rank.
